    What is going on in this pic

    Why is Elric having people bleed in his bathwater?

    • In this version, instead of brewing up rare herbs to give him strength, Elric uses magics discovered by Cymoril, involving the bleeding of slaves.
      On the one hand, a good way of showing Melnibonean decadence, and making Cymoril a stronger character than Moorcock’s original.
      On the other hand, it gives Elric a vampiric nature before he finds the vampiric sword Stormbringer. This weakens Stormbringe as a metaphor.
